Q: Is 1,646,676 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 1,646,676 is a composite number.

Why is 1,646,676 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 1,646,676 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 4 6 9 12 18 27 36 54 79 108 158 193 237 316 386 474 579 711 772 948 1,158 1,422 1,737 2,133 2,316 2,844 3,474 4,266 5,211 6,948 8,532 10,422 15,247 20,844 30,494 45,741 60,988 91,482 137,223 182,964 274,446 411,669 548,892 823,338 and 1,646,676, with no remainder.

Since 1,646,676 cannot be divided by just 1 and 1,646,676, it is a composite number.
